宝塔通过node项目布署twikoo

-
-
2024-07-29

1、宝塔面板网站里面切换到NODE项目,根据提示安装好NODE.JS,记住NODE.JS的安装目录,因为宝塔安装的不是全局,后面的调用NODE需要带上执行文件目录。

2、然后随便找个你想放twikoo的目录,比如我的是/home/www/node_project/twikoo,在宝塔文件下定位到该目录,然后打开终端

输入下面命令,按提示一步步生成package.json

/www/server/nodejs/v14.17.6/bin/npm init

再执行下面的命令安装tkserver

/www/server/nodejs/v14.17.6/bin/npm install tkserver --save

3、安装好之后,编辑目录下package.json,加入下面一段,里面的TWIKOO_PORT就是环境变量用于指定启动服务的端口,你们看着改成自己的

"scripts": {
    "start": "TWIKOO_PORT=9003 ./node_modules/.bin/tkserver"
  },

最终的样子:

4、完成了上面的准备工作,我们就可以在NODE项目里面添加了。启动命令里面就有了上面添加的start了,见下图

5、然后你就可以用nginx 或 caddy这类你喜欢的WEB服务器进行反代了。这里就不多说了,如有问题,留言反馈。

6、twikoo的前端怎么调用,参考下面的链接:

https://twikoo.js.org/frontend.html

“您的支持是我持续分享的动力”

微信收款码
微信
支付宝收款码
支付宝

目录